I can't recall seeing the 17" Punch installed on the JK but this model is available in the following dimension:

17x8.5 ET+18 (5.45" BS) Level 8 Punch
17x8.5 ET-6 (4.5" BS) Level 8 Punch

The most common is the 17x8.5 ET-6 as it gives a wider stance over stock and can accommodate tires up to 35" in diameter (assuming proper lift).
